The intersection of funk and soul
The Pointer Sisters reinterpret the Black musical tradition.
This is a representative early work that explores the roots of jazz, blues, and R&B. The sisters' outstanding harmony work allows them to freely sing songs in a variety of styles. This work laid the foundation for their later commercial success, and fully demonstrates the richness of their musical backgrounds.
